Effects and Evaluation of the Physicochemical, Biochemical and Microbiological Quality of Powder Obtained from Stored Cashew Nuts in Bondoukou, Côte d'Ivoire

Overview

Analysis reveals good physicochemical quality and microbiological safety in cashew kernels, suggesting safe food use.

Key Points

  • Cashew nut powders demonstrated satisfactory physicochemical quality based on dry matter and moisture content.
  • Microbiological analysis indicated loads of Bacillus cereus within acceptable limits, pointing to food safety.
  • No significant differences in quality were found among samples from different storerooms in Bondoukou.
  • The findings confirm that cashew nuts can be safely utilized for food production due to their quality attributes.
